    We have Operations Apprentice opportunities to join our Process & Pumping department at Yorkshire Water and be a part of helping Yorkshire Water to provide the best service to our customers. Could this be you?

    What we do:

    Everyone has an idea of what a water company does. Here in Yorkshire, we make sure that over 5.4 million people living in the region and the millions of people who visit our region each year, can rely on our services, and have clean and safe drinking water on tap and that their wastewater is taken away. But for us, it's so much more than this.

    We look after communities, protect the environment, and plan to look after Yorkshire's water, today, tomorrow 24/7, 365 days a year. We provide essential water and wastewater services to every corner of the Yorkshire region, and play a key role in the region's health, wellbeing, and prosperity.

    New environmental legislation, unprecedented levels of investment and changing expectations from customers means that this is an exciting time to discover opportunities within the water industry. Process and Pumping, within the wider Wastewater part of the business, plays a key part in how we plan to meet the changing expectations of customers and regulators.
